NBA superstar LeBron James has made a groundbreaking move in the world of trading cards, as he recently signed an exclusive multi-year partnership with Fanatics Collectibles. This marks the end of his long-standing relationship with Upper Deck, concluding a previous card and memorabilia contract.

To mark the beginning of this partnership, Fanatics will release a special card featuring LeBron and his son, Bronny James. This highly anticipated card will be part of the 2023-24 Bowman University Chrome Basketball set and will be available from January 19th. The limited-edition card will feature a 1/1 on-card dual autograph, showcasing LeBron in his St. Vincent-St. Mary’s high school uniform and Bronny in his USC Trojans jersey. The set will also include other basketball talents, such as women’s college basketball All-Americans Caitlin Clark and Paige Bueckers, among its 100 players.

LeBron’s decision to part ways with Upper Deck after more than two decades was a significant move. Upper Deck acknowledges their longstanding collaboration and the role they played in establishing LeBron’s brand as a highly valuable collectible. They also recognize their collaborative efforts with the LeBron James Family Foundation. Upper Deck expressed gratitude for having had LeBron as part of their family and wished him well in his future endeavors.
